SAN BEST AND WORST MOMENTS

Papa San - Stock PhotoPapa San did something like that, living as Papa San the dancehall deejay and non-Christian, and Papa San the gospel artiste and Christian.

It is therefore not surprising, that Papa San has not been able to erase from his mind his worst and best moments.

WORST

The worst moment in Papa San's life, came at a point when he was well on his way to making it to the top of his dancehall career. According to San, he was held with an illegal firearm by the police in 1993 and thrown in jail.

The deejay says that this situation only brought shame and embarrassment to him, as being a dancehall artiste and being in the public eye, it wasn't healthy for his career to be slapped with charges of possession of illegal firearm. Also, at the time when he was held with the gun, he was in the company of another woman (not his wife).
